Unit Operation > Radio Page To initialize the unit: 1. Take the Rino 520/530 outside where there is an unobstructed view of the sky and turn it on. 2. The unit begins to search for satellite signals. A Satellite Signal graph is displayed on the Radio page or you can get more detailed information by accessing the Satellite Page from the Main Menu. 3. The first time you initialize your Rino it could take up to five minutes. When the GPS is initialized and ready for navigation, three or more green GPS signal bars are displayed. If for some reason the unit is not able to gather the necessary satellite information, refer to the GPS Troubleshooting Chart in the Appendix. Using Name and Symbol Fields The Name field allows you to enter a name that appears on other Rino units as you communicate with them. You may enter a name using a combination of up to 10 letters, numbers, or spaces. The Symbol field allows you to choose a face icon from a list to further personalize your identity. Symbol Field Name Field Radio Status Face options GPS Status To enter a name: 1. Using the Thumb Stick, highlight the Name field. Press the Thumb Stick In to activate the field and display the keyboard. 2. Move the Thumb Stick Up, Down, Left, or Right to highlight the Clear field, then press the Thumb Stick In to clear the default Name. 3. To enter a new name, use the Thumb Stick to move the cursor to the desired character (letter, number, or a space). Press the Thumb Stick In to select that highlighted character.
